What is ChatGPT?
ChatGPT is an AI language model (Large Language Model or LLM) published by OpenAI in 2022. Although the tool is prominent, it is by no means the only LLM – Gemini, Deepseek, Claude or Mistral are now just as good or well on the way to becoming so. All of them are trained with text fragments from books, articles and the Internet. They understand language, answer questions, write texts, help with programming and can communicate almost naturally.

Challenges & risks: Limitations of ChatGPT for companies
It is clear that the use of ChatGPT makes sense for companies. However, this does not mean that there are no pitfalls:
- Data protection & confidentiality: depending on the license of the model, the prompts entered are also used for the training of ChatGPT. Sensitive data should therefore not be used here. Even a ChatGPT Plus license does not change this.
- Quality control: AI-generated content should always be checked to avoid errors or misunderstandings. Especially when insufficient data is available, LLMs like ChatGPT tend to hallucinate – they invent plausible-sounding but factually incorrect content. Even if ChatGPT-4 is already more suitable for companies thanks to advances in this field.
- Acceptance within the team: Not all employees are open to AI tools – transparent change management is required.

Prompts as a success factor
The quality of the prompts determines the quality of the results. The simplest option is to use a framework that already contains prompts for all relevant use cases. For individual prompts, you should pay attention to the C.R.A.F.T. principle:
- C – Context: Give the enterprise AI solution all relevant background information so that it understands the task and the framework.
- R – Role: Assign the AI a specific role or persona (e.g. “You are an experienced travel consultant”) to guide the perspective of the response.
- A – Action: Formulate what you want the AI to do as a clear instruction for action (e.g. “Create a list …” or “Analyze the following text …”).
- F – Format (format): Specify the format in which the response is expected (e.g. as a table, list, continuous text).
- T – Tone: Specify the desired style or tone of the response (e.g. factual, friendly, detailed).
Clear guidelines and governance
Define who may use ChatGPT, how and for what purpose. Data protection, compliance and responsibilities should be clearly regulated when using AI in the company.
Training & change management
Train your employees in its use, e.g. through AI workshops. Only those who know the possibilities and limitations can use ChatGPT sensibly for companies. Providing information also helps to contain unrealistic expectations or fears, e.g. the fear of losing one’s job.
What does ChatGPT cost for companies?
How much ChatGPT costs for companies depends on your use case. As previously mentioned, the free versions of ChatGPT and Deepseek are often sufficient for trivial scenarios. If you want to use ChatGPT Enterprise – e.g. for data protection reasons – the costs are only available on direct request. 60 dollars per user and month seems to be a common average value.
Individual AI solutions for companies that are based on ChatGPT often have higher initial costs, but offer a better return on investment in the medium to long term.
Is ChatGPT free for commercial use?
In principle, it is also possible to use the free version of ChatGPT as a company. However, when using this AI in your company, you forgo the security features of the paid versions that OpenAI offers for companies and must take correspondingly stricter precautions.
